MGZT vs Rover 75, please explain..
Hi all - I've been looking for a pre facelift 75 for months now as i want a really really good one. As i've been getting nowhere fast, i've started looking at MGZT's and have seen a nice looking diesel one on ebay with quite a low mileage. I want a 75 as i want a car that i can do all the maintenance on myself, and parts and info seem readily available. If i bought an MGZT would i still be able to look after it myself or are there so many differences between the MGZT and normal 75 that maintaining it would become a nightmare? If parts and info are difficult to come by then i'd sooner keep looking for a nice 75. Any help from experienced owners would be greatly appreciated!
Ta, Phil. |

From a maintenance point of view the differences are cosmetic e.g. 18inch wheels, stiffer suspension etc

ZT's are a harder ride - more sporty suspension set up - engines are identical across both cars - body styling is different . Both cars can be fettled easily compared to modern cars. Parts are readily available for both.
